depends on the sport and how rigorous the testing is

in cycling the testing has worked.. stage times are well down.. armstrong never got caught, but he sure would have done in today's environment

american sports are yet to catch-up and allow blood testing.. in the nba for example they are limited to two urine tests a year before ?April - so if your team makes it to the playoffs its pretty much open season.. their player unions carry a lot more power
